|
131 | 131 | ] |
132 | 132 | }, |
133 | 133 | "scripts": { |
| 134 | + "clean": "npx rimraf dist generated node_modules", |
134 | 135 | "ci:test": "run-s test:*", |
135 | 136 | "dep-check": "aegir dep-check src/**/*.ts test/**/*.ts generated/**/*.ts", |
136 | 137 | "fix": "run-s fix:*", |
137 | | - "fix:gen": "./npm-scripts/fix/gen.sh", |
138 | 138 | "fix:lint": "aegir lint --fix", |
139 | 139 | "lint": "run-s lint:*", |
140 | 140 | "lint:main": "aegir lint", |
141 | | - "lint:ts": "aegir ts -p check -- -p tsconfig.json --suppress 6133@generated 6192@generated --stats", |
| 141 | + "lint:ts": "aegir ts -p check", |
142 | 142 | "lint-TODO:project": "check-aegir-project # currently broken due to corrupting the repoUrl", |
143 | 143 | "release": "aegir release", |
144 | | - "postinstall": "npm run gen && patch-package", |
145 | | - "build": "aegir build -- -p tsconfig.json --suppress 6133@generated 6192@generated --stats", |
146 | | - "build:main": "aegir build -- -p tsconfig.json --suppress 6133@generated 6192@generated --stats", |
| 144 | + "postinstall": "run-s gen", |
| 145 | + "build": "aegir build", |
| 146 | + "build2": "tsc-silent -p tsconfig.generated.json --suppress 6133@generated 6192@generated --stats", |
| 147 | + "build:main": "aegir build", |
147 | 148 | "build:docs": "aegir ts docs", |
148 | | - "build:types": "aegir ts -p types -- -p tsconfig.json --suppress 6133@generated 6192@generated --stats", |
| 149 | + "build:types": "aegir ts -p types", |
149 | 150 | "test": "run-s test:*", |
150 | 151 | "test:browser": "aegir test --target browser", |
151 | 152 | "test:webworker": "aegir test --target webworker", |
152 | 153 | "test:electron": "aegir test --target electron-main", |
153 | 154 | "test:node": "aegir test --target node --cov && npx nyc report", |
154 | 155 | "pregen": "openapi-generator-cli validate -i https://raw.githubusercontent.com/ipfs/pinning-services-api-spec/v1.0.0/ipfs-pinning-service.yaml", |
155 | 156 | "gen": "run-p gen:fetch", |
156 | | - "postgen": "run-s fix:gen", |
| 157 | + "postgen": "tsc-silent -p tsconfig.generated.json --suppress 6133@generated 6192@generated --stats", |
157 | 158 | "gen:fetch": "openapi-generator-cli generate --generator-key fetch", |
158 | 159 | "gen:node": "openapi-generator-cli generate --generator-key node", |
159 | 160 | "gen:ts": "openapi-generator-cli generate --generator-key ts" |
|
0 commit comments